Parcourir la source

部署后提示用户更新15

tyler il y a 2 ans
Parent
commit
a93d9e4f7b
1 fichiers modifiés avec 6 ajouts et 2 suppressions
  1. 6 2
      src/App.vue

+ 6 - 2
src/App.vue

@@ -20,11 +20,13 @@ export default {
       if (language === 'en') {
       if (language === 'en') {
         self.$confirm('System update detected, please refresh the page?', '📢 System update', {
         self.$confirm('System update detected, please refresh the page?', '📢 System update', {
           distinguishCancelAndClose: true,
           distinguishCancelAndClose: true,
+          closeOnClickModal: false,
           confirmButtonText: 'refresh',
           confirmButtonText: 'refresh',
           cancelButtonText: 'dismiss'
           cancelButtonText: 'dismiss'
         })
         })
           .then(() => {
           .then(() => {
-            self.$router.go(0)
+            // self.$router.go(0)
+            location.reload()
             self.$message({
             self.$message({
               type: 'info',
               type: 'info',
               message: 'Refresh successful'
               message: 'Refresh successful'
@@ -41,11 +43,13 @@ export default {
       } else {
       } else {
         self.$confirm('检测到系统更新,请刷新页面?', '📢 系统更新', {
         self.$confirm('检测到系统更新,请刷新页面?', '📢 系统更新', {
           distinguishCancelAndClose: true,
           distinguishCancelAndClose: true,
+          closeOnClickModal: false,
           confirmButtonText: '刷新',
           confirmButtonText: '刷新',
           cancelButtonText: '放弃'
           cancelButtonText: '放弃'
         })
         })
           .then(() => {
           .then(() => {
-            self.$router.go(0)
+            // self.$router.go(0)
+            location.reload()
             self.$message({
             self.$message({
               type: 'info',
               type: 'info',
               message: '刷新成功'
               message: '刷新成功'